Squares R6C3 and R6C8 in row 6 form a simple naked pair. These 2 squares both contain the 2 possibilities <17>. Since each of the squares must contain one of the possibilities, they can be eliminated from the other squares in the row.

R6C1 - removing <7> from <3457> leaving <345>

R6C5 - removing <1> from <145> leaving <45>

R6C7 - removing <7> from <247> leaving <24>

R6C9 - removing <1> from <123> leaving <23>

Intersection of row 5 with block 5. The value <1> only appears in one or more of squares R5C4, R5C5 and R5C6 of row 5. These squares are the ones that intersect with block 5. Thus, the other (non-intersecting) squares of block 5 cannot contain this value.

R4C5 - removing <1> from <145> leaving <45>

Squares R4C5 and R6C5 in column 5 form a simple naked pair. These 2 squares both contain the 2 possibilities <45>. Since each of the squares must contain one of the possibilities, they can be eliminated from the other squares in the column.

R3C5 - removing <4> from <124> leaving <12>

R9C5 - removing <5> from <125> leaving <12>

Squares R9C5 and R9C9 in row 9 form a simple naked pair. These 2 squares both contain the 2 possibilities <12>. Since each of the squares must contain one of the possibilities, they can be eliminated from the other squares in the row.

R9C6 - removing <1> from <157> leaving <57>

Squares R4C5 and R6C5 in block 5 form a simple naked pair. These 2 squares both contain the 2 possibilities <45>. Since each of the squares must contain one of the possibilities, they can be eliminated from the other squares in the block.

R5C4 - removing <4> from <147> leaving <17>

R5C6 - removing <4> from <147> leaving <17>
